Robert Half Sr. Event Planner in Chapel Hill, North Carolina
Description
We are offering a contract for a Sr. Event Planner position in Chapel Hill, North Carolina. As part of the job, you will be expected to handle tasks related to event planning, budget processes, calendar management, and travel arrangements coordination.
Responsibilities:
• Plan and execute special events, ensuring smooth conduct and success
• Utilize ADP - Financial Services for financial management related to events
• Manage the calendar effectively, scheduling and organizing meetings and conference calls
• Coordinate detailed travel and accommodation arrangements, both domestic and international
• Use Concur and CRM for efficient management of expenses and customer relationships, respectively
• Create and manage banner ads for event promotion and marketing
• Oversee budget processes to ensure financial efficiency for each event
• Address customer inquiries and resolve issues promptly
• Maintain accurate records of each event, from planning to execution to post-event analysis
• Process customer credit applications accurately and efficiently.
